Aston Villa vs Tottenham Kickoff 10.00am EST
Aston Villa -0.5 @ 2.53 $200 to win $306

Villa have yet to lose a game this season and even manager Martin O'Neill is expecting defeat sooner than later. Villa lost a key player upfront in Luke Moore who will be sidelined for 6 months due to shoulder surgery. This means that the right flank that has caused problems for many teams will be weakened.
Tottenham on the other hand are off to a disasterous start. They have yet to score on the road losing all 3 encounters with a -6 goal difference. Paul Robinson, who let in the howler during midweek for England against Croatia will get the nod in net. I still believe he's feeling the effects about that embarassment and will get a rough tune from the crowd. Don't think the Spurs can take anything out of this match today except try and score a goal. I am tempted to play the under as well but with the Spurs you aren't too sure what you can get, they have the quality but they have yet to display it.
Prediction: Aston Villa 1-0 Tottenham

Palermo vs Atalanta
Palermo ML @ 1.57 $875 to win $500

This is my biggest bet of the season. Palermo have outdone a lot of critics this season. Not only did they manage to dispose of West Ham Utd in UEFA Cup, but they have been on a tear in the Serie A. 2nd on the table level on points with Roma at the top, Palermo have always been one of the better sides at home. During Atalanta's last tenure at the Serie A in 2004/2005 season, this team accumulated only 1 victory on the road, 5 draws and 13 defeats. A lot of promoted clubs have troubles on the road during their first season but along time they will have adjusted. Well don't think they can adjust here. Only 2 games in on the road this season, Atalanta have yet to score a goal, doesn't bode too well.
